It is engineered for industrial cooling tower systems operating with moderately contaminated process water.
- Product Type: Offset Fluted Cooling Tower Fill
- Tower Compatibility: Counterflow Cooling Towers
- Water Quality Tolerance: Moderate suspended solids and contaminated process water
- Corrugation Flute Height: 0.82 in (20.8 mm)
- Specific Surface Area: 45 ft²/ft³ (147.8 m²/m³)
- Void-to-Volume Ratio: Minimum 95% open area
- Material Thickness Options:
- 10 mil (0.25 mm)
- 15 mil (0.38 mm)
- Material Options: PVC, High-Temperature PVC (HPVC), Polypropylene (PP)
- PVC Temperature Limit: Up to 160°F (71°C)
- HPVC Temperature Limit: Up to 175°F (79°C)
- Construction Compliance: CTI Standard 136 compliant
- Standard Module Heights: 11.8 in (300 mm) and 23.6 in (600 mm)
- Module Width: Up to 18 in (458 mm)
- Module Length Range: 12 in to 120 in (305 mm to 3,048 mm)
